Output 877331ebbb7b3cac4be9613dd07b4e11832fe099bbd8db760ad00a38262e4852:1

value
636692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f3d1e0ce74bf0d425f3e102e0f7ab85aab096e3 OP_EQUAL
address
3Lao1mCsCJvUZ44tmTmhbKKuZZrDVmgBNe
transaction
877331ebbb7b3cac4be9613dd07b4e11832fe099bbd8db760ad00a38262e4852
confirmations
382103
spent
true